One of the key advantages of CNC machining is its versatility. This advanced technology allows manufacturers to work with a variety of materials, including aluminum, titanium, and composite substances commonly used in aerospace engineering. Moreover, CNC machines can produce a wide range of components, from small fixtures to large structural elements, making them indispensable in the aerospace supply chain.
